Issues and Ethical Implications


The growth of unsolicited feedback apps presents several challenges that organizations must navigate carefully. One significant issue is the potential for misuse, where individuals may utilize the anonymity to articulate negativity or engage in harassment without responsibility. This can create a poisonous environment, detracting from the constructive feedback that these platforms aim to promote. Organizations need to establish clear guidelines and moderation policies to mitigate the risk of harmful content while still promoting candid communication.


Another factor is the impact on trust within teams. While anonymity can empower employees to voice concerns they might otherwise withhold, it can also lead to suspicion and increased tension if team members feel that their colleagues are sharing confidential or detrimental feedback without facing consequences. To create a positive environment, it is essential for organizations to promote a culture of openness, ensuring that anonymous feedback does not substitute direct communication channels but rather complements them.


Finally, ethical concerns regarding data privacy and security cannot be overlooked. Organizations must ensure that the feedback collected is safe and handled responsibly. This involves being transparent about how data is processed, stored, and utilized, as well as providing users with assurances that their anonymity will be protected. Balancing the need for valuable insights with the imperative to respect individual privacy is a critical issue that must be addressed to maintain the integrity of anonymous feedback platforms.
